Purpose for the Position:

To lead, support, and develop all BOH team members. To supervise all food prep, ordering, and line execution standards and protocols set forth by management.

Essential Responsibilities:
  • Leads, trains & mentors food preparation staff including recruitment and hiring, coaching development, performing evaluations, and progressive discipline.
  • Collaborates on the creation, management and operation within departmental budget and expense plans to maximize revenue and profits.
  • Schedules all team members under their supervision, maintaining adequate staffing levels while adhering to labor standards guidelines.
  • Supervises all cooking operations.
  • Assists with development of menus when needed.
  • Oversees and maintain appropriate levels of food and small wares inventory.
  • Responsible for scheduling equipment maintenance and cleaning.
  • Adhere to company/brand standards and service levels to increase sales and minimize costs, including food, beverage, supply, utility and labor costs.
  • Assists the management team with all shift management functions in both the front and back of the house.
  • Ensures 100% recipe adherence and plating specifications.
  • Maintains health and sanitation standards and keep a clean and safe working environment.
  • Must be able to visibly recognize condition of food and cooking temperature.
  • Supports team member recognition and engagement programs.
  • Reports to work for scheduled shift, on time and in uniform in accordance with company policy.
  • Knows and complies with all company policies and procedures pertaining to this position and its duties.
  • Embrace O’Reach, Green Team, Guest Service, Team Member Satisfaction, Health & Wellness, and Safety culture.
  • Performs other duties and responsibilities as required or requested.
